‧開發CMS,提供內部上傳專案及每天自動寄一封E-Mail給未結案專案承辦人
‧開發FTP,提供內部專案下載點
‧利用MQTT傳輸藍牙燈具、智慧插座、智慧手環及Sensor的Data
‧開發時因Database設定錯誤導致無法直接刪除被關聯的Parent Row,更改Cascade設定解決
‧開發時因Race Condition導致重複發資料,以Queue的方式一次僅抓一筆資料解決
‧開發時因Race Condition導致UART被同時寫入資料造成硬體當機,以Semaphore限制最大執行緒數量為1解決
‧發現內部使用的SDK在某個變數為0時會造成Infinite Recursion,增加Corner Case的判斷後解決
‧原先內部使用的SDK為利用JSON檔做資料的讀取及寫入,但遇到斷電檔案會毀損、且讀寫效率極差導致CPU使用率經常滿載,分析資料結構後建立Database解決